Dunbar Merrill was born on June 20, 1984, in the United States. His childhood was far from easy, as his family faced financial hardship after losing everything in a money laundering scandal. At the tender age of fifteen, Dunbar was forced to become emancipated, taking on the responsibilities of adulthood much sooner than most of his peers.
Despite the financial obstacles he faced, Dunbar was determined to further his education. He enrolled in the military to help pay for his schooling at the University of Mississippi. After completing his studies, Dunbar earned a degree and pursued a career as a real estate broker.
In 2007, Dunbar made his reality television debut on MTV's The Real World: Sydney. This experience catapulted him into the world of reality TV, leading to appearances on various seasons of The Challenge, including The Island, The Duel II, The Ruins, and Cutthroat. His charismatic personality and competitive spirit quickly made him a fan favorite among viewers.
Aside from his reality TV career, Dunbar has also tried his hand at acting. He has appeared in feature films such as The Terror Experiment and Texas Heart, showcasing his versatility as a performer.
